44问答网
所有问题
当前搜索:
最短路径有向图
求
有向图
两个顶点间的
最短路径
的方法,用简单语言或举例描述。_百度知 ...
答:
从
有向图
可看出,顶点v1到v4的
路径有
3条:(v1,v2,v4),(v1,v4),(v1,v3,v2,v4 ),其路径长度分别为:15,20和10。因此v1到v4的
最短路径
为(v1,v3,v2,v4 )。为了叙述方便,我们把路径上的开始点称为源点,路径的最后一个顶点为终点。那么,如何求得给定有向图的单源最短路径呢?迪...
如何依次找到无
向图
的 前k k 条
最短路径
答:
利用 Dijkstra 算法求得
有向图
(N,A) 中以开始节点 s 为根的
最短路径
树(注意,这里的最短路径树并不是最小生成树,因为 Dijkstra 算法并不保证能生成最小生成树),标记从开始节点 s 到结束节点 t 之间的最短路径为 pk , k=1 。2.如果k小于要求的最短路径的最大数目K,并且仍然有候选...
...算法求图中从顶点a到其他各顶点间的
最短路径
,并写出执行算法过程中...
答:
迪克斯加(Dijkstra)算法(
最短路径
算法)是由荷兰计算机科学家艾兹格·迪科斯彻发现的。算法解决的是
有向图
中任意两个顶点之间的最短路径问题。举例来说,如果图中的顶点表示城市,而边上的权重表示著城市间开车行经的距离。 迪科斯彻算法可以用来找到两个城市之间的最短路径。迪科斯彻算法的输入包含了一...
单源
最短路径
_单源结点最短路径
答:
(1)
有向图
采用邻接矩阵表示。 (2) 单源结点的
最短路径
问题采用狄克斯特拉算法。 (3) 输出有向图中从源结点到其余各结点的最短路径和最短路径值。 四、测试数据 测试数据为如下图所示的有向带权图,以结点v1作为源结点,求从结点v1到其余各结点的最短路径和最短路径的长度值。 图 有向带权图 五、算法...
用dijkstra算法计算源点到个结点的
最短路径
...谢谢亲爱的朋友~ 详细...
答:
Dijkstra算法的具体步骤:Dijkstra算法又称为单源
最短路径
,所谓单源是在一个
有向图
中,从一个顶点出发,求该顶点至所有可到达顶点的最短路径问题。设G=(V,E)是一个有向图,V表示顶点,E表示边。它的每一条边(i,j)属于E,都有一个非负权W(I,j),在G中指定一个结点v0,要求把从v0...
找
最短路径
的方法
答:
1),深度或广度优先搜索算法(解决单源
最短路径
)从起始结点开始访问所有的深度遍历路径或广度优先路径,则到达终点结点的
路径有
多条,取其中路径权值最短的一条则为最短路径。给定一个带权
有向图
G=(V,E),其中每条边的权是一个实数。另外,还给定V中的一个顶点,称为 源。现在要计算从源到...
图遍历算法之
最短路径
Dijkstra算法
答:
Dijkstra算法,翻译作戴克斯特拉算法或迪杰斯特拉算法,于1956年由荷兰计算机科学家艾兹赫尔.戴克斯特拉提出,用于解决赋权
有向图
的 单源
最短路径
问题 。所谓单源最短路径问题是指确定起点,寻找该节点到图中任意节点的最短路径,算法可用于寻找两个城市中的最短路径或是解决著名的旅行商问题。问题描述 :...
求如下
有向图
的关键
路径
以及任意两点之间的
最短
距离?
答:
用CPM算法求
有向图
的关键路径和用Dijkstra算法求有向图的
最短路径
的C语言程序如下 include <stdio.h> include <malloc.h> include <stdlib.h> include <string.h> define MAX 20 define INF 32767 // 此处修改最大值 define nLENGTH(a) (sizeof(a)/sizeof(a[0]))define eLENGTH(a) ...
运筹学求从v1到v8的
最短路径
答:
运筹学求从v1到v8的
最短路径
:1-2-5-7标号时要注意不要遗漏。最短路径是用于计算一个节点到其他所有节点。主要特点是以起始点为中心向外层层扩展,直到扩展到终点为止。Dijkstra算法能得出最短路径的最优解,但由于它遍历计算的节点很多,所以效率低。结点 求最短路径的问题。确定终点的最短路径问题...
对于所示的带权
有向图
,求从顶点0到其他各顶点的
最短路径
。
答:
算法就不说了,数据结构的书上写得很清楚,某度百科上也列出了n种现成的代码,自己慢慢啃总能明白。如下是结果:
1
2
3
4
5
6
7
8
9
10
涓嬩竴椤
其他人还搜
有向图最短路径没有路径
有向图最短路径最快计算方法
赋权有向图最短路径
有向图最短路径求解
有向图的最短路径算法
有向图最短路径算法例题
带权有向图最短路径
有向图最短路径表格
加权有向图的最短路径算法